Employment Law

The Employment Attorney Group at Harrison & Moberly assists clients with a broad range of employment law and labor law matters such as union avoidance, employment litigation, and employment counseling. Our attorneys have experience representing clients before federal and state agencies, as well as federal and state courts.

We advise Firm clients on a broad range of employment law and labor matters including employment contract disputes, covenants not to compete, affirmative action and employment discrimination, wrongful discharge, sexual harassment, wage and hour and family leave disputes, and trade secret protection. We assist employers in implementing personnel policies and manuals, mediating and arbitrating employment law and labor disputes. Our attorneys are active in the business community, are part of the International Law Network, and frequently publish articles or give seminars on employment and labor matters.

The Employment Law Attorney Group routinely distributes a newsletter advising clients of recent changes in the law as well as strategies for better addressing employment law issues that face the business community.
